gpt4 book ai didi

svn - 哪个协议(protocol)? svn ://or http(s)://?

转载 作者:可可西里 更新时间:2023-11-01 15:03:46 24 4
gpt4 key购买 nike

SVN网络访问的常用协议(protocol)有四种。

svn://repos
svn+ssh://repos
https://repos
http://repos

维基百科页面并没有太多说明四种不同协议(protocol)的区别。我一直更喜欢 svn://,因为它最容易设置,但有什么区别,哪个“更好”?

最佳答案

http:// 有一个严重的开销,尤其是在处理数以千计的小文件时。我将 svn 用于一个拥有大约 50,000 个图标的网站,所有图标都保存在 SVN 中。使用 HTTP,结帐大约需要 20 分钟。一旦我切换到 svn://,它只用了不到一分钟。这是因为对于 HTTP,它是每个文件一个新的 HTTP 请求。

http:// 但是有以下很大的优势:它通常会穿过防火墙。例如,现在我切换到 svn://,因为他们的防火墙,我无法再从我的大学访问我的存储库。

关于是否使用 SSL/TLS 的区别,很明显:数据已加密;但是设置起来比较困难。

关于svn - 哪个协议(protocol)? svn ://or http(s)://?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2140954/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com